Climate Impact & Sustainability Data (2022, 2023)

Reporting Period: 2022

Environmental Metrics

Total Carbon Emissions:189.181,30 tCO2e (without cat12)
Scope 1 Emissions:1.554,88 tCO2e
Scope 2 Emissions:977,76 tCO2e
Scope 3 Emissions:186.198,91 tCO2e

Environmental Achievements

  • Successfully reduced Scope 2 emissions by 93.2% by switching purchased electricity. Direct Scope 1 emissions were reduced by 12.4%.
  • Developed a high-performance absorber that reduces activated carbon container emissions by up to 90% and consumes up to 90% less energy in production than conventional products.
  • Increased use of recycled materials in production, saving over 50% energy compared to virgin materials in some components.

Environmental Challenges

  • Not all countries can obtain electricity from renewable sources.
  • Material requirements can greatly limit supplier selection.
  • Technical possibilities in existing processes only allow for limited potential for optimization.
  • Increased activated carbon consumption due to stricter emission regulations leading to higher transport costs and CO2 emissions.
  • Increased demand for raw materials for activated carbon production due to stricter emission regulations.
Mitigation Strategies
  • Defined goals for suppliers: Scope 1, 2 & 3 data submission from 2028, CO2 neutrality for Scope 1 and 2 by 2030, complete CO2 neutrality by 2035.
  • Development of intelligent and sustainable solutions, including a high-performance absorber.
  • Increased use of recycled materials.
  • Research and development of products for alternative drive markets.
  • Switching to digital global purchasing files to reduce paper use.

Reporting Period: 2023

Environmental Metrics

Total Carbon Emissions:2214.47 tCO2e (2023)
Scope 1 Emissions:622.32 tCO2e (2023)
Scope 2 Emissions:1199.58 tCO2e (2023)
Scope 3 Emissions:209637.14 tCO2e (2023)

Climate Goals & Targets

Long-term Goals:
  • Achieve CO2 neutrality by 2038.
Medium-term Goals:
  • CO2 neutrality for Scope 1 and Scope 2 by 2030.
  • Complete CO2 neutrality for all scopes by 2035.
Short-term Goals:
  • Reduce absolute Scope 1 and 2 GHG emissions 50.4% by 2032 from a 2021 base year.
  • Reduce absolute Scope 3 GHG emissions (purchased goods and services and capital goods) 30.0% by 2032 from a 2021 base year.
